Lithuania is a low-lying, mostly agricultural Baltic state in northeast Europe. It is the largest of the three Baltic states, covering approximately 65,300 square kilometers, and had a population of 2.9 million in 2025.
- Independence Day (February 16): Commemorates independence from the Russian Empire in 1918.
- Restitution of Independence (March 11): Marks the restoration of independence from the Soviet Union.
- St John's Day (June 24): Traditionally observed as midsummer's day.
- Statehood Day (July 6): Celebrates the coronation of Mindaugas in 1253, the first King of Lithuania.
- Christmas (December 25): A recognized national holiday.
- The society is generally traditional and conservative, though Vilnius is a cosmopolitan area. Roman Catholicism is the primary religion, supplemented by Lutheran and Orthodox Christian groups. National identity is a notable aspect of modern Lithuanian life.
